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99014 3821180780 32 16867833 380134
097734 453 1051
097734 453 1051
62336948339 381908 69
All about undefined
Interested in learning more?
097734 453 1051
62336948339 381908 69
See more
1091 1693 692
27529 35419777648 7940
See more
19364823 8382629
0402293938 96527781519 74
See more